Greystar is a distinguished, fully integrated global real estate company specializing in property management, investment management, development, and construction services with a particular focus on institutional-quality rental housing. Established in 1993 by Bob Faith and headquartered in Charleston, South Carolina, Greystar has grown to become the largest operator of apartments in the United States and a leading figure in the global real estate market. The company manages and operates a vast portfolio exceeding $300 billion in real estate assets across nearly 250 markets worldwide, including offices in North America, Europe, South America, and the Asia-Pacific region. Job Duties

  • Inspects the community throughout the day to remove litter, debris, and pet droppings and ensure all common areas and amenities are neat and free of litter at all times
  • Removes trash and remaining items from vacant apartments prior to starting the make-ready process, transfers trash to dumpster or storage area as applicable, and cleans and maintains storage areas
  • Completes assigned minor and routine service requests as requested by Service Supervisor and/or Community Manager, and assists the make-ready specialist in the turn process
  • Changes all locks in accordance with the property's policy and ensures gates to all pool areas are working according to codes and safety standards
  • Distributes notices and communications to residents as necessary
  • Informs appropriate supervisors of any observed hazard or potentially dangerous situation for residents, team members, guests and others
  • Demonstrates customer service skills by treating residents and others with respect, answering resident questions, and responding sensitively to complaints about maintenance services
